Background
The existing watering device is used for maintaining cement road surfaces, and is also used for cleaning road surfaces, sanitation, dust prevention, watering, pesticide spraying and the like in units such as urban roads, large factories, armies, gardens and the like so as to beautify the environment. And can also be used for temporary emergency fire fighting. The detachable large-capacity water tank is used for high-pressure flushing or sprinkling water on the road surface; the high-pressure water gun is arranged, so that the surfaces of facilities such as tunnels, sound insulation walls and the like can be cleaned, the device is convenient to operate and effectively utilized during operation;
the prior art has the following problems:
1. when the device is operated, the internal fan is inconvenient to be dustproof, and dust falling into the surface of the fan is easy to cause to influence the rotating effect of the fan;
2. when the watering device is frequently rotated during operation, the support is easy to shake unstably, and the watering effect of the device is influenced.
In order to solve the problems, the application provides a watering device for cement pavement maintenance.

Referring to fig. 1, fig. 2, fig. 3, fig. 4 and fig. 5, the present invention provides a technical solution: a watering device for maintaining a cement pavement comprises a box body 1, the upper surface of the box body 1 is rotatably connected with a connecting rod 7 through a bearing, the end part of the connecting rod 7 is integrally formed with a bracket 5, a watering device main body 4 is fixedly arranged in the bracket 5, a dust screen 8 is arranged in the watering device main body 4, a clamping groove 12 is arranged at the edge of the dust screen 8, a groove 10 is arranged at the inner edge of the watering device main body 4, a compression spring 9 is fixedly welded in the groove 10, the end part of the compression spring 9 is elastically connected with a clamping head 11, the compression spring 9 and the dust screen 8 are tightly pressed and fixed with the clamping groove 12 through the clamping head 11, the dust screen 8 can be placed in the watering device main body 4, the end part of the clamping head 11 is tightly pressed in the clamping groove 12 through the effect that the compression spring 9 generates elastic deformation in the groove 10, the dust screen 8 can be used for preventing dust in an internal fan during operation after, effectively use, the outer surface welded fastening of connecting rod 7 has connecting plate 6, equal welded fastening all around of connecting plate 6 has link 3, roll groove 13 has been seted up to link 3's bottom, the inside roll connection in roll groove 13 has ball 2, and link 3 and box 1 are through roll groove 13 and ball 2 roll connection, in this embodiment, rotate through support 5 and drive connecting rod 7 and pass through the bearing rotation in box 1's inside, connecting rod 7 drives connecting plate 6 and link 3 when rotating this moment, rotate link 3 and box 1's upper surface with the inside of roll groove 13 by ball 2 and sticis, it is connected to sticis through link 3 when making support 5 rotate with connecting rod 7, be convenient for more stable when adjusting support 5.
Specifically, the inner surface of the rolling groove 13 is of an arc structure, and the outer surface of the ball 2 is matched with the inner surface of the rolling groove 13.
In this embodiment, the balls 2 roll in the rolling grooves 13, so that the connecting frame 3 and the upper surface of the box 1 roll stably to support and connect.
Specifically, the connecting rod 7 is of an annular structure, and the connecting rod 7 penetrates through the connecting plate 6.
In this embodiment, in order to rotate through connecting rod 7 and drive connecting plate 6 and link 3 and rotate for the device operation is stable.
Specifically, the dust screen 8 is of an annular structure, and the dust screen 8 is matched with the internal structure of the sprinkler body 4.
In this embodiment, the dust screen 8 is fixed inside the sprinkler body 4 so as to prevent dust from entering the internal fan, and the dust screen 8 is used for fixing the internal fan.
Specifically, the end of the chuck 11 is a semicircular structure, and the end of the chuck 11 has the same structure as the inner surface of the slot 12.
In this embodiment, the locking head 11 is engaged with the locking groove 12 to press the dust screen 8 tightly at a predetermined position in the sprinkler body 4.
The utility model discloses a theory of operation and use flow: before the watering device for maintaining the cement pavement is used, the dust screen 8 is firstly placed in the watering device body 4, the end part of the clamping head 11 is tightly pressed in the clamping groove 12 under the action of elastic deformation of the pressing spring 9 in the groove 10, the dust prevention of the internal fan is conveniently realized through the dust prevention net 8 during operation after the pressing and the fixing, the use is effective, then when the sprinkler body 4 is adjusted by the bracket 5 in use, the bracket 5 rotates to drive the connecting rod 7 to rotate in the box body 1 through the bearing, at the moment, the connecting rod 7 rotates to drive the connecting plate 6 and the connecting frame 3 to rotate, the ball 2 rotates in the rolling groove 13 to tightly press the connecting frame 3 and the upper surface of the box body 1, make support 5 and connecting rod 7 compress tightly through link 3 when rotating and be connected, be convenient for more stable when adjusting support 5.
